South Asian rhinoplasty is a specialized procedure designed to enhance the appearance and function of the nose while preserving each patient’s natural ethnic identity. Individuals of South Asian heritage often have unique nasal characteristics, including a broader bridge, thicker skin, rounded nasal tip, or wider nostrils. Every patient has different facial proportions, making a personalized surgical approach essential for achieving balanced and natural-looking results. Rather than creating a standardized nose shape, the goal is to improve harmony between the nose and the rest of the face while maintaining cultural identity.
During the initial consultation, Dr. Saadat performs a comprehensive evaluation of the patient’s facial anatomy, nasal structure, skin thickness, cartilage strength, breathing function, and aesthetic concerns. Patients are encouraged to discuss their expectations openly so realistic goals can be established. Advanced imaging and careful surgical planning help determine the most appropriate techniques for each individual.
Depending on the patient’s needs, surgery may involve refining the nasal tip, improving bridge definition, reducing nostril width, correcting asymmetry, or addressing functional breathing problems. Modern rhinoplasty techniques focus on preserving structural support while creating subtle refinements that enhance facial balance without making the nose appear artificial.
Recovery generally includes mild swelling and bruising that improve gradually over several weeks. Patients should avoid strenuous exercise, protect the nose from accidental injury, follow all post-operative instructions, and attend scheduled follow-up appointments. Final results continue to develop over several months as swelling resolves naturally.
